O que é : Cryptographic Primitive

Introdução

Um Cryptographic Primitive, ou Primitiva Criptográfica, é um componente básico de um sistema de criptografia que descreve um algoritmo ou protocolo utilizado para proteger informações sensíveis. Essas primitivas são essenciais para garantir a segurança e a privacidade dos dados transmitidos pela internet e armazenados em dispositivos eletrônicos. Neste glossário, vamos explorar em detalhes o que é uma Cryptographic Primitive e como ela é fundamental para a segurança cibernética.

O que é uma Cryptographic Primitive?

Uma Cryptographic Primitive é um bloco de construção fundamental de um sistema de criptografia que pode ser utilizado para realizar operações criptográficas, como criptografia, descriptografia, autenticação e geração de chaves. Essas primitivas são projetadas para serem seguras e eficientes, garantindo a confidencialidade, integridade e autenticidade dos dados.

Tipos de Cryptographic Primitives

Existem vários tipos de Cryptographic Primitives, cada um com sua própria função e características únicas. Alguns dos tipos mais comuns incluem algoritmos de criptografia simétrica, algoritmos de criptografia assimétrica, funções de hash criptográficas e protocolos de segurança.

Algoritmos de Criptografia Simétrica

Os algoritmos de criptografia simétrica utilizam a mesma chave para criptografar e descriptografar os dados. Alguns exemplos populares de algoritmos simétricos incluem o AES (Advanced Encryption Standard) e o DES (Data Encryption Standard).

Algoritmos de Criptografia Assimétrica

Os algoritmos de criptografia assimétrica utilizam um par de chaves, uma pública e uma privada, para criptografar e descriptografar os dados. Exemplos de algoritmos assimétricos incluem o RSA (Rivest-Shamir-Adleman) e o ECC (Elliptic Curve Cryptography).

Funções de Hash Criptográficas

As funções de hash criptográficas são utilizadas para transformar dados em uma sequência de bytes de tamanho fixo, conhecida como hash. Essas funções são amplamente utilizadas para verificar a integridade dos dados e garantir que não foram alterados durante a transmissão.

Protocolos de Segurança

Os protocolos de segurança são conjuntos de regras e procedimentos que garantem a segurança das comunicações e transações realizadas na internet. Alguns exemplos de protocolos de segurança incluem o SSL/TLS (Secure Sockets Layer/Transport Layer Security) e o IPsec (Internet Protocol Security).

Importância da Cryptographic Primitive

As Cryptographic Primitives desempenham um papel fundamental na segurança cibernética, garantindo que os dados sensíveis sejam protegidos contra acessos não autorizados e ataques maliciosos. Sem essas primitivas, as informações transmitidas pela internet estariam vulneráveis a interceptações e manipulações.

Aplicações da Cryptographic Primitive

As Cryptographic Primitives são amplamente utilizadas em uma variedade de aplicações, incluindo comunicações seguras, transações financeiras, armazenamento de dados sensíveis e autenticação de usuários. Essas primitivas são essenciais para garantir a segurança e a privacidade das informações em ambientes digitais.

Desafios da Cryptographic Primitive

Apesar de sua importância na segurança cibernética, as Cryptographic Primitives também enfrentam desafios, como a evolução constante das técnicas de ataque e a necessidade de atualizações regulares para garantir a segurança dos sistemas. É fundamental que os desenvolvedores e pesquisadores estejam sempre atentos às novas ameaças e vulnerabilidades.

Conclusão

Em resumo, uma Cryptographic Primitive é um componente essencial de um sistema de criptografia que desempenha um papel crucial na proteção dos dados sensíveis. Ao compreender a importância e os desafios associados a essas primitivas, é possível garantir a segurança e a privacidade das informações em ambientes digitais cada vez mais complexos e interconectados.